Solventless stretchable ink composition |
摘要 |
An ink composition suitable for ink jet printing, including printing on deformable substrates. In embodiments, the stretchable ink composition is based on a solventless monomer-based ink formulation comprising a mixture of acrylic ester oligomer and monomers of acrylic ester and aromatic acrylate. |

主权项 |
1. A solventless stretchable ink composition comprising:
a mixture of an acrylic ester oligomer, an acrylic ester monomer and an aromatic acrylate monomer, wherein the acrylic ester monomer has a viscosity of from about 1.0 to about 8 cps at the printing temperature; a photoinitiator; and a colorant, wherein the stretchable ink composition is capable of printing and forming images on a deformable substrate, and the image printed with the stretchable ink composition after curing has a first lower glass transition temperature of from about −70 to about 0° C. and a second higher glass transition temperature of from about 25 to about 80° C. |
